About the role
This role is focused on ensuring high levels of customer satisfaction by responding to and resolving customer questions or concerns.
Our Customer Service Representatives work in one of our fast-paced and energetic Customer Contact Centers and have the opportunity to directly interact with our valued customers every day. Inbound customer calls are most often related to topics like pricing, billing, and scheduling. Customer retention is a key element, so ensuring customer satisfaction and cultivating long-term relationships is an important part of the role.
Responsibilities
- Helping ensure customer satisfaction by resolving customer issues/questions related to service, billing, or other matters
- Documenting customer information and call history accurately for future reference
- Processing orders for new services requested
- Maintaining up-to-date knowledge and understanding of features of Terminix products and services, marketing promos, and special offers
- Preparing correspondence and coordinating with other functions as necessary to resolve issues
